Responsibilities

  • Have full knowledge of laboratory procedures and processes per protocol, laboratory manual, shipping manual, etc.
  • Assist the laboratory manager in site preparation for study conduct.
  • Assist in the creation of laboratory documents (i.e. harvest logs, etc.)
  • Assist in the preparation of collection tubes, vials, study supplies for visits.
  • Monitor temperature of laboratory sample storage and address any excursions.
  • Maintain harvest logs, chain of custody, laboratory sample manifest/inventory logs and/or memos.
  • Pack and properly label all study materials for storage or return to sponsor upon study close out.
  • Obtains samples per protocol and documents process in source documents.
  • Processes samples according to protocol.
  •   Ensures centrifuge settings are appropriate for processing according to protocol.
  • Performs regular inventory of supplies and orders as needed to ensure lab supplies are adequate and available for study visits.
  • Stores samples in an upright position in appropriate shipping boxes in the freezer.
  •   Stores primary and secondary samples in separate shipping boxes.
  • Ensures freezer/refrigerator temperature is within range for protocol and ensures appropriate logs are kept.
